6802. tsenephah
Lexicon
tsenephah: Whirlwind, storm

Original Word: צְנֵפָה
Part of Speech: Noun Feminine
Transliteration: tsnephah
Pronunciation: tseh-neh-fah'
Phonetic Spelling: (tsen-ay-faw')
KJV: X toss
Word Origin: [from H6801 (צָּנַף - attired)]

1. a ball

Strong's Exhaustive Concordance
toss

From tsanaph; a ball -- X toss.

see HEBREW tsanaph

NAS Exhaustive Concordance
Word Origin
see tsanaph.

Brown-Driver-Briggs
צְנֵפָה noun feminine winding; — Isaiah 22:18, see [צנף].
